What is the amount of the Social Accompaniment Program in March 2026

The Social Accompaniment Program provides a monthly assistance of $78,000 to eligible beneficiaries in March 2026.

In March 2026, beneficiaries of the Social Accompaniment Program in Argentina will receive a monthly financial assistance of $78,000. This amount has remained unchanged since 2023, highlighting a consistent support structure for those in need. The program is specifically designed to assist individuals over 50 years of age or mothers with four or more children under 18, aiming to provide economic relief to vulnerable populations.

The payment will be credited to beneficiaries' accounts on the fifth business day of each month, which for March 2026 falls on March 6.
